Description Join a team of mission-driven Behavior Technicians bringing ABA therapy to the children and schools that need it most. At VBA, you'll work 1:1 with students, help support their path forward, and build skills that will fuel your career in behavioral health - all while working a schedule you can count on.

$500 sign-on bonus for RBTs, $300 sign-on bonus for entry-level!

Now hiring BTs to work in schools throughout South San Diego County, including National City, Chula Vista, Bonita, San Ysidro, Otay Ranch, Central San Diego, La Mesa, and El Cajon.

What you'll do

Work 1:1 with children with special needs to build communication, self-help, social, and play skills Implement behavior plans designed by BCBAs, adapting techniques to each student's needs Track progress through behavior data collection and clinical notes Attend ongoing training to sharpen your skills and grow your ABA career Pay & Schedule $20.00–$27.00/hour, plus paid drive time and mileage between sessions

Consistent, school-day hours (typically 7:30 AM–3:30 PM) Part-time and full-time hours available; full-time starts at 30 hrs/week Full-time benefits (30+ hrs/week): Guaranteed hours for your first 30 days - no waiting on caseload to build before you start earning Paid sick leave and PTO Health, vision, and dental insurance Flexible Spending Account Life insurance 401(k) with company plan Cell phone stipend Referral bonuses for bringing new talent to

VBA

Get certified while you work: We pay for your training and shadowing as you earn your Registered Behavior Technician (RBT®) certification, with direct support from BCBAs. Non-billable time, including training, is paid at prevailing minimum wage.

Experience working with children and/or disabilities is desirable, but not required.

We hire experienced RBTs and those just entering the field. If you’re passionate about helping kids learn, we’ll give you the training and guidance to succeed.

To apply, you'll need

  • A high school diploma or equivalent (some college preferred); must be 18+ A reliable vehicle and valid driver's license
  • Availability at least 3 weekdays, 7:30 AM–3:30 PM If hired, you'll also need to be able to pass a Live Scan background check and TB test, as well as provide proof of MMR and TDap vaccination.
